The upfront FHA mortgage insurance is always required and cannot be changed. However, your lender may be able to adjust your interest rate upward and give you a credit from the excess profit from the loan, to help pay the 1.75% upfront mortgage insurance premium. FHA Cash-Out Refinance loans have a maximum loan-to-value of 85 percent of the home’s current value. Payment History Requirements Documentation is required to prove that the borrower has made all the monthly payments for the previous 12 months.
